Recommended Suspension Enhancement for a Tandem Axle Trailer With 3.5K Overslung Axles
Question:
Hello, I have a tandem axle travel trailer with 3500lb electric break lippert axles. The frame width is 71 from edge to edge with Overslung mount. I would like to upgrade to larger weight capacity axles along with leaf springs and wheels. Could you help me with getting the correct parts together and pricing. Thank you for your time.
asked by: Dru H
Expert Reply:
You could upgrade your axles to a higher capacity, however it isn't really recommended since it can create a rougher ride.
Since you've got 3,500 lb axles I'd stick with those and upgrade your suspension with the SumoSprings Trailer Helper Springs w/ Line Relocation Bracket # TSS-107-40.
These springs are going to help improve handling while providing additional support for an overall more smooth and comfortable ride.
Also, since you're looking for new leaf springs, I am going to need you to measure from eye to eye on your current springs and let me know what that is so I can find you the correct springs.
Same deal with your wheels, let me know what you have and I'd be happy to shoot you a couple of recommendations. There are a couple of help article I've attached for you to check out that will walk you through how you can measure your wheels.
